Uma ontologia para a representação do domínio de agricultura familiar na arquitetura AgroMobile. Roger Alves Prof. Me.



Documentos relacionados
ONTOLOGIA DE DOMÍNIO PARA ANÁLISE DE BLOGS

PROJETO DE REDES

Modelagem Conceitual de uma Solução de Integração para o Processo de Rematrícula da Universidade Unijuí

Ontologias. Profa. Lillian Alvares Faculdade de Ciência da Informação, Universidade de Brasília

FERRAMENTA PARA CRIAÇÃO DE BASES DE CONHECIMENTO NA FORMA DE ONTOLOGIA OWL A PARTIR DE DADOS NÃO ESTRUTURADOS

L A C Laboratory for Advanced Collaboration

Mestranda: Márcia Maria Horn. Orientador: Prof. Dr. Sandro Sawicki

Protégé-OWL Tutorial. Adriano Melo André Chagas Fred Freitas. Sistemas Inteligentes

O padrão RDF na descrição de imagens

UNIVERSIDADE DO ESTADO DE SANTA CATARINA - UDESC DCC Departamento de Ciência da Computação Joinville-SC

Uso de taxonomias na gestão de conteúdo de portais corporativos.

INSTITUTO VIANNA JÚNIOR LTDA FACULADE DE CIENCIAS ECONOMICAS VIANNA JUNIOR

Tópicos em Engenharia de Software (Optativa III) AULA 2. Prof. Andrêza Leite (81 )

Protégé Desenvolvimento de contologias

Revisão da Literatura Tema 2. Mestranda: Arléte Kelm Wiesner

Cadernos UniFOA. Web Semântica: Uma Rede de Conceitos. Semantic Web: A Network of ConceptsONCEPTS

Uma Proposta de Framework de Comparação de Provedores de Computação em Nuvem

Prof.: Clayton Maciel Costa

Arquitetura de Software

Oficina. Praça das Três Caixas d Água Porto Velho - RO

Semântica para Sharepoint. Busca semântica utilizando ontologias

UNIVERSIDADE FEDERAL DO ESTADO DO RIO DE JANEIRO ESCOLA DE INFORMÁTICA APLICADA CURSO DE BACHARELADO EM SISTEMAS DE INFORMAÇÃO

Conjunto de conceitos que podem ser usados para descrever a estrutura de um banco de dados

Dado: Fatos conhecidos que podem ser registrados e têm um significado implícito. Banco de Dados:

Utilização de Recursos da Web Semântica na Construção de um Ambiente Web para Publicação Científica Indexada e Recuperada por Ontologias

Diagrama de Classes. Um diagrama de classes descreve a visão estática do sistema em termos de classes e relacionamentos entre as classes.

Disciplina de Banco de Dados Parte V

Web Semântica. Web Semântica. uma

UNIVERSIDADE FEDERAL DO PARANÁ UFPR Bacharelado em Ciência da Computação

Bancos de Dados. Conceitos F undamentais em S is temas de B ancos de Dados e s uas Aplicações

Introdução à Engenharia de Software

ORGANIZAÇÃO CURRICULAR

Tecnologia para Sistemas Inteligentes Apontamentos para as aulas sobre. Introdução à Representação e Processamento de Ontologias: Framework O3f

ONTOLOGIA E SUAS APLICAÇÕES EM MODELAGEM CONCEITUAL PARA BANCO DE DADOS PROPOSTA DE TRABALHO DE GRADUAÇÃO

Introdução à construção de ontologias

Web Semântica e Matching de Ontologias: Uma Visão Geral

MC536 Bancos de Dados: Teoria e Prática

Universidade Estadual Paulista Faculdade de Filosofia e Ciências Campus de Marília Grupo de Estudos sobre Organização e Representação do Conhecimento

Modelagem do Conhecimento para a Gestão de Processos e Projetos. Modelagem do Conhecimento para a Gestão de Processos e Projetos Prof.

Agenda. Modelo de Domínio baseado em Ontologia para acesso à Informações de Segurança Pública. George Fragoso

Sistemas Distribuídos Arquitetura de Sistemas Distribuídos I. Prof. MSc. Hugo Souza

Modelo de Dados. Modelo para organização dos dados de um BD

Curso de Aprendizado Industrial Desenvolvedor WEB. Disciplina: Banco de Dados Professora: Cheli Mendes Costa Modelo de Dados

Engenharia de Software I

MC536 Bancos de Dados: Teoria e Prática

SABiO: Systematic Approach for Building Ontologies

Vejamos abaixo duas definições para ontologias:

Engenharia de Software I: Análise e Projeto de Software Usando UML

Banco de Dados Aula 02. Colégio Estadual Padre Carmelo Perrone Profº: Willian

Ensino Técnico Integrado ao Médio FORMAÇÃO PROFISSIONAL. Plano de Trabalho Docente 2014

Banco de Dados. Conceitos e Arquitetura de Sistemas de Banco de Dados. Profa. Flávia Cristina Bernardini

ENGENHARIA DA COMPUTAÇÃO BANCO DE DADOS I CONTEÚDO 5 ABORDAGEM RELACIONAL

Padrões, Ferramentas e Boas Práticas no Desenvolvimento de Software para Web Semântica

TRABALHO DE DIPLOMAÇÃO Regime Modular ORIENTAÇÕES SOBRE O ROTEIRO DO PROJETO FINAL DE SISTEMAS DE INFORMAÇÕES

Ciclo de Desenvolvimento de Sistemas de BD

Modelos de Sistema by Pearson Education. Ian Sommerville 2006 Engenharia de Software, 8ª. edição. Capítulo 8 Slide 1.

Faculdade Lourenço Filho - ENADE

Modelo de Dados. Modelos Conceituais

OWL e Protégé-2000 na definição de uma ontologia para o domínio Universidade

UNIVERSIDADE REGIONAL DE BLUMENAU CENTRO DE CIÊNCIAS EXATAS E NATURAIS CURSO DE CIÊNCIAS DA COMPUTAÇÃO (Bacharelado)

UML - Unified Modeling Language

EP-RDF: SISTEMA PARA ARMAZENAMENTO E RECUPERAÇÃO DE IMAGENS BASEADO EM ONTOLOGIA

FACULDADE INTEGRADAS DE PARANAÍBA ADMINISTRAÇÃO DE EMPRESAS. Bancos de Dados Conceitos Fundamentais

Persistência e Banco de Dados em Jogos Digitais

Engenharia de Domínio baseada na Reengenharia de Sistemas Legados

BANCO DE DADOS 1 AULA 1. estrutura do curso e conceitos fundamentais. Professor Luciano Roberto Rocha. contato@lrocha.

ALESSANDRO RODRIGO FRANCO FERNANDO MARTINS RAFAEL ALMEIDA DE OLIVEIRA

Modelagem de Processos. Prof.: Fernando Ascani

LINGUAGENS E PARADIGMAS DE PROGRAMAÇÃO. Ciência da Computação IFSC Lages. Prof. Wilson Castello Branco Neto

Empresa de Informática e Informação do Município de Belo Horizonte S/A PRODABEL

Requisitos de Software

Engenharia de Requisitos

Introdução Introdução

EMENTAS DAS DISCIPLINAS

Uma Ontologia para Estruturação da Informação Contida em Laudos Radiológicos

ProgramaTchê Programação OO com PHP

3 Trabalhos relacionados

do grego: arkhé (chefe ou mestre) + tékton (trabalhador ou construtor); tekhne arte ou habilidade;

2 Engenharia de Software

Fatores de Qualidade de Software

XML (extensible Markup Language)

Rumo a Implantação de Soluções de Integração na Nuvem

Banco de Dados I. Introdução. Fabricio Breve

UNIVERSIDADE FEDERAL DO CEARÁ CAMPUS QUIXADÁ BACHARELADO EM SISTEMAS DE INFORMAÇÃO MARCELO CABRAL BATISTA

CICLO DE VIDA DE UM BD

Padrões, Ferramentas e Boas Práticas no Desenvolvimento de Software para Web Semântica

3 Modelo de Controle de Acesso no Projeto de Aplicações na Web Semântica

Processos de Desenvolvimento de Software

Banco de Dados 1 2º Semestre

Uma Ontologia para Gestão de Segurança da Informação

Padrões de Projeto. Prof. Jefersson Alex dos Santos

Uma Proposta de Integração de Sistemas Computacionais Utilizando Ontologias

Ontologia Aplicada ao Desenvolvimento de Sistemas de Informação sob o Paradigma da Computação em Nuvem

PROVA DE CONHECIMENTOS ESPECÍFICOS PROGRAMADOR DE COMPUTADOR. Analise as seguintes afirmativas sobre os modelos de processos de software:

Integração da Informação e do Conhecimento no Contexto da Copa do Mundo e os Jogos Olímpicos no Brasil

Organização de Computadores 1. Prof. Luiz Gustavo A. Martins

O Processo Unificado: Captura de requisitos

Web Atual. O que é? WEB SEMÂNTICA. Web hoje é... O que é a web. Web Atual é Sintática!!! Web hoje é...sintática

Conteúdo. Disciplina: INF Engenharia de Software. Monalessa Perini Barcellos. Centro Tecnológico. Universidade Federal do Espírito Santo

Transcrição:

Uma ontologia para a representação do domínio de agricultura familiar na arquitetura AgroMobile Roger Alves Prof. Me. Vinícius Maran

O que é uma ontologia? Palavra vinda do grego, advinda da união entre ontos "ente" e logoi, "ciência do ser Desde sua criação no século VI, e dentro do meio filosófico, designa a parte da metafisica que trata da natureza, realidade e existência dos entes.

Definição bibliográfica de ontologia Uma ontologia é uma especificação formal explicita de uma conceitualização compartilhada. Fensel (2001) Uma ontologia é um conjunto de termos ordenados hierarquicamente para descrever um domínio que pode ser usado como um esqueleto para uma base de conhecimentos. Gómez-Pérez (1999)

Ontologia na Ciência da Computação Uma ontologia um conjunto de primitivas representacionais com as quais modela um domínio do discurso ou de conhecimento. Primitivas conhecidas como: Classes Atributos Relacionamentos

Ontologia de circuitos eletrônicos http://www2.dbd.puc-rio.br/pergamum/tesesabertas/0024134_02_cap_04.pdf

Tipos de Ontologias [ GCA Prof. Dra. Applied Fabricia Computing Roos-Frantz Research / Prof. Group Dr. Rafael Z. Frantz ]

Linguagens para Ontologia [ GCA Prof. Dra. Applied Fabricia Computing Roos-Frantz Research / Prof. Group Dr. Rafael Z. Frantz ]

Evolução das linguagens para criação de ontologias XML sintaxe para estruturar documentos. Não impõem restrições semânticas. XML Schema restringe a estrutura de documentos XML RDF modelo de dados para objetos e relacionamentos. Semântica simplificada RDF Schema vocabulário para descrever propriedades e classes de RDF. Semântica para generalização. DAML+OIL, OWL maior vocabulário para descrever classes e propriedades (relacionamentos, e.g., disjunção, cardinalidade, igualdade

OWL OWL em Março de 2003 Linguagem recomendada pelo W3C Revisão do DAML+OIL Possui três sublinguagens: OWL Lite Owl DL (Description Logics) mapeamento para DAML+OIL Owl Full

Engenharia de Ontologias Disciplina criada com o objetivo de sustentar o desenvolvimento de ontologias Engloba as atividades de: Projeto Construção Avaliação Validação Manutenção Integração Compartilhamento Reutilização

Methontology Especificação Conceituação Integração Implementação (formalização) Avaliação

Processo de desenvolvimento de Ontologias Protégé-2000 determine scope consider reuse enumerate terms classes properties constraints Na realidade um processo interativo: create instances determine scope consider reuse enumerate terms consider reuse classes enumerate terms classes properties classes properties constraints create instances classes create instances consider reuse properties constraints create instances

Do léxico para ontologia C R A O H C rel Ontologia Processo de construção de ontologias Lv Lo Lsj Lst Léxico

Do léxico para ontologia Baseado em um sistema de códigos que compreende: Símbolos Noções (Conotações) Impactos (Efeitos ou Denotação) Conjunto de descrições Cada símbolo é descrito através de noções e impactos Símbolo = entrada.

Símbolos do Léxico Tipos Sujeito Verbo Objeto Situação

Protégé [ GCA Prof. Dra. Applied Fabricia Computing Roos-Frantz Research / Prof. Group Dr. Rafael Z. Frantz ]

Domínio da Agricultura de Precisão Modelagem de Domínio da Agricultura de Precisão Entidades Informações Relacionamentos Processos Representação de situações e informações de contexto Representação de recomendações e ações da arquitetura [ GCA Prof. Dra. Applied Fabricia Computing Roos-Frantz Research / Prof. Group Dr. Rafael Z. Frantz ]

Trabalhos Relacionados Gleidson Antônio Cardoso da Silva et al (2006) reitera que com o aumento exponencial dos dados, em diversas áreas de aplicação, ocorreu uma motivação para pesquisas em técnicas que visam a melhorias no tratamento e na recuperação da informação. Nesse contexto, ontologias são usadas em diferentes domínios, como uma alternativa para a organização da informação e sistematização de conceitos e conhecimentos.

Trabalhos Relacionados Sobre a importância da organização de dados no contexto atual da computação, Mauricio B. Almeida et al (2009), reitera que apesar das ontologias não apresentarem sempre a mesma estrutura, existem características e componentes básicos comuns presentes em grande parte delas. Mesmo apresentando propriedades distintas, é possível identificar tipos bem definidos.

Ontologia atual [ GCA Prof. Dra. Applied Fabricia Computing Roos-Frantz Research / Prof. Group Dr. Rafael Z. Frantz ]

Próximos passos Léxico -> Ontologia Restrições Relações Regras (situações) Integração com a arquitetura População da ontologia Inferência Validação

Referências Bibliográficas Gleidson Antônio Cardoso da Silva et al, ONIAQUIS UMA ONTOLOGIA PARA A INTERPRETAÇÃO DE ANÁLISE QUÍMICA DO SOLO, 2006. Disponível em: http://sites.unifra.br/portals/36/2006/oniaquis.p df Mauricio B. Almeida et al, Uma visão geral sobre ontologias: pesquisa sobre definições, tipos, aplicações, métodos de avaliação e de construção, 2009. Disponível em: <http://www.scielo.br/pdf/ci/v32n3/19019>

Obrigado por sua atenção! Contato: Roger Alves roger_thatt@hotmail.com